The English Channel and North Atlantic Ocean are the geographic scope for this dataset. It contains surface underway measurements of barometric pressure, partial pressure of carbon dioxide in atmosphere and water, sea surface salinity, and temperature. The data were collected by NOAA_NCEI from the MN Colibri vessel between January and August 2019.
